mirror of
https://github.com/BookStackApp/BookStack.git
synced 2024-09-20 08:16:04 +00:00
Demo mode: Updated my account access to be more selective
This commit is contained in:
parent
e006f9674f
commit
49b286cd34
@ -20,7 +20,6 @@ class UserAccountController extends Controller
|
|||||||
) {
|
) {
|
||||||
$this->middleware(function (Request $request, Closure $next) {
|
$this->middleware(function (Request $request, Closure $next) {
|
||||||
$this->preventGuestAccess();
|
$this->preventGuestAccess();
|
||||||
$this->preventAccessInDemoMode();
|
|
||||||
return $next($request);
|
return $next($request);
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
@ -53,6 +52,8 @@ class UserAccountController extends Controller
|
|||||||
*/
|
*/
|
||||||
public function updateProfile(Request $request, ImageRepo $imageRepo)
|
public function updateProfile(Request $request, ImageRepo $imageRepo)
|
||||||
{
|
{
|
||||||
|
$this->preventAccessInDemoMode();
|
||||||
|
|
||||||
$user = user();
|
$user = user();
|
||||||
$validated = $this->validate($request, [
|
$validated = $this->validate($request, [
|
||||||
'name' => ['min:2', 'max:100'],
|
'name' => ['min:2', 'max:100'],
|
||||||
@ -143,6 +144,7 @@ class UserAccountController extends Controller
|
|||||||
*/
|
*/
|
||||||
public function updateNotifications(Request $request)
|
public function updateNotifications(Request $request)
|
||||||
{
|
{
|
||||||
|
$this->preventAccessInDemoMode();
|
||||||
$this->checkPermission('receive-notifications');
|
$this->checkPermission('receive-notifications');
|
||||||
$data = $this->validate($request, [
|
$data = $this->validate($request, [
|
||||||
'preferences' => ['required', 'array'],
|
'preferences' => ['required', 'array'],
|
||||||
@ -178,6 +180,8 @@ class UserAccountController extends Controller
|
|||||||
*/
|
*/
|
||||||
public function updatePassword(Request $request)
|
public function updatePassword(Request $request)
|
||||||
{
|
{
|
||||||
|
$this->preventAccessInDemoMode();
|
||||||
|
|
||||||
if (config('auth.method') !== 'standard') {
|
if (config('auth.method') !== 'standard') {
|
||||||
$this->showPermissionError();
|
$this->showPermissionError();
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user